When selecting a treadmill, numerous features can enhance the user experience. Here's a list of vital features to consider:
Motor Power: Measured in horse power (HP), a motor's power significantly influences performance. For casual walkers, a motor of 1.5-2.0 HP is adequate, while major runners might require 2.5 HP or more.
Running Surface: Check the size of the running belt (usually measured in length and width). A longer and wider belt is better for runners, whereas walkers may manage with a smaller sized area.
Cushioning: Treadmill cushioning systems help soak up effect, reducing strain on joints. Search for designs with adjustable cushioning if you have particular joint concerns.
Incline Options: Incline features include range to workouts and assist target various muscle groups. Some treadmills use motorized incline modifications, while others may have manual settings.
Foldability: If area is an issue, think about a collapsible treadmill. With ingenious styles, they are easy to keep when not in use.
Show and Connectivity: Opt for treadmills with LCD displays that supply vital workout metrics. Furthermore, many modern-day treadmills use connection alternatives for apps and online workouts.
Cost: Prices for treadmills in the UK can differ widely, so develop a budget plan before shopping.
